Co-founder of the Saudi Civil and Political Rights Association (ACPRA) and and a former profession in Islamic Jurisprudence in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.
Arrest and jail information
- Prison: Buraydah Prison, al-Qassim
 - Date of arrest: 9 March 2013
 - Manner of arrest: Arrested at the Criminal Court in Buraydah
 
Trial information
- Charges: Disobeying the ruler of the country; incitement against the Saudi regime; damaging the country’s reputation; co-founding a civil association (ACPRA); disseminating information to foreign entities
 - Court: Specialised Criminal Court (SCC)
 - Verdict: 10-year prison term and 10-year travel ban
 - Date of verdict: 19 October 2015
 
Violations
- Arbitrary arrest/ detention
 
Timeline
-  
                                    7 January 2023 - He is released following the expiry of his sentence. He remains under a ten-year travel ban.
 -  
                                    19 October 2015 - He is sentenced to 10 years in prison followed by ten years of travel ban.
 -  
                                    09 March 2013 - He is arrested at the Criminal Court in Buraydah.
 -  
                                    2013 - He is originally sentenced to eight years in prison after a trial before a criminal court but his sentence is later overturned.
